Our first week of summer camp begins 17-21 July for children 8-12 years old. 🎉

Imagine, discover, and create, meet new friends 👦🏼👧🏼 and collaborate🥳

Monday: Wild Wild West 🤠 😜 & Cardboard City, build your own camper 🚐 or tiny cute Coffee Shop☕️

Tuesday: Lego day, Build a sundial!
Using lego blocks, campers will work in teams to build a sundial as a way to tell time without using a clock 🕰️

Wednesday: Prehistoric Lab, Dig for fossils & Cave Art- Roars will be heard throughout campus today as Day Camp turns back the time and becomes surrounded by dinosaurs.

Thursday: An introduction to Letter Writing ✍🏻, Creative writing for kids and Hilarious Homophones - commonly confused words:) 🫤

Funky Friday: Red, White&Blue Party 🎊 & Glow in the dark Sand Art 🖼️

Parents: Please provide necessary sun protection and a change of clothes.

Kids: expect a week that is full of exploration, games and fun 🤩, balanced with art, stories, and snacks😜

Today’s story: The Boy Who Cried Wolf, is one of Aesop's Fables. 📖 From it is derived the English idiom "to cry wolf", defined as "to give a false alarm" in eBrewer's Dictionary of Phrase and Fable[2] and glossed by the Oxford English Dictionary as meaning to make false claims, with the result that subsequent true claims are disbelieved.🤫
